Fail safe mode on 1g auto trannies

Well, it hit me on the way over to my mother's house as to what's wrong with Terina's tranny. It won't shift up or down from 2nd gear. It works fine in reverse, neutral and park. I remembered reading a while back in the owner's manual that if the tranny detects a malfunction, it will go into safe mode. It will only have one forward gear (either 2nd or 3rd). The only thing they say to do is take it to the dealer to have them diagnose it.

My question is, is there any way to diagnose it without going to the dealer? Any codes to read or anything? I changed the tranny filter and oil tonite because the old stuff was brown. It had almost 25,000 miles on the last change. I also put some lubegard in it. I have a spare tranny sitting here but I really don't want to have to swap it out if there is an easier fix.
